ADHD and Substance Use: New Research Reveals Complex Neurological Connections

New clinical research indicates that up to 50% of adults with ADHD develop problematic substance use patterns, challenging traditional addiction treatment approaches and highlighting the need for specialised intervention strategies.
Neurological Foundation Drives Vulnerability
Recent neuroimaging studies confirm that ADHD involves measurable differences in dopamine production and receptor function. Dr. Sarah Mitchell, a neuropsychiatrist at Stanford Medicine, explains that these neurological variations affect multiple brain systems simultaneously.
"The ADHD brain operates with consistently lower baseline dopamine levels," Mitchell notes. "This creates genuine deficits in motivation processing, attention regulation, and executive function that individuals often attempt to address through available substances."
Clinical observations reveal that substance use in this population frequently represents unconscious self-medication rather than recreational behavior. Common targets include stimulants for focus enhancement, depressants for overstimulation management, and various substances for emotional regulation.
Self-Medication Patterns Documented
Research teams have identified consistent self-medication patterns among adults with ADHD:
Stimulation Seeking: Studies show elevated rates of caffeine dependence, nicotine use, and both prescribed and unprescribed stimulant access among individuals seeking cognitive enhancement.
Evening Regulation: Clinical data reveals significant alcohol and cannabis use patterns specifically for managing hyperactivity and achieving restful sleep.
Emotional Management: Research documents substance use correlating with episodes of emotional overwhelm, particularly during periods of rejection sensitive dysphoria—a newly recognized ADHD symptom involving intense emotional responses to perceived criticism.
Dr. James Rodriguez, addiction specialist at Johns Hopkins, emphasizes that impulsivity differences in ADHD create unique risk factors. "The neurological gap between impulse and action is demonstrably smaller in ADHD brains, creating vulnerability to rapid substance use decisions."
Treatment Approaches Evolving
Traditional abstinence-only addiction treatment models show limited effectiveness for ADHD populations, according to recent clinical trials. Dialectical Behavior Therapy (DBT) adaptations incorporating harm reduction principles demonstrate improved outcomes.
Key innovations include:
Distress Tolerance Training: Teaching specific coping strategies for managing urges without requiring immediate abstinence goals.
Emotion Regulation Skills: Addressing underlying emotional dysregulation through evidence-based techniques rather than focusing solely on substance elimination.
Mindfulness Adaptations: Modified mindfulness practices designed for ADHD attention patterns, emphasizing conscious choice-making over automatic behavioral responses.
Clinical Implementation Challenges
Healthcare providers report significant barriers to treating this intersection effectively. Dr. Lisa Chen, director of dual diagnosis services at UCLA Medical Center, identifies multiple systemic issues.
"Most addiction treatment programs lack ADHD expertise, while ADHD clinics often have limited substance use training," Chen observes. "This creates gaps in care precisely where integrated treatment is most crucial."
Current treatment limitations include insufficient ADHD screening in addiction settings, limited access to ADHD medication during substance use treatment, and stigma within both treatment communities.
Professional Recommendations
Leading researchers advocate for integrated treatment models addressing both conditions simultaneously. Recommended approaches include:
Comprehensive Assessment: Screening for ADHD in all addiction treatment settings and substance use patterns in all ADHD evaluations.
Medication Coordination: Careful consideration of ADHD stimulant medications alongside substance use treatment, with appropriate monitoring protocols.
Skill-Based Interventions: Teaching practical alternatives to substance use for managing ADHD symptoms, including environmental modifications and behavioural strategies.
Support System Development: Building networks that understand both ADHD challenges and substance use recovery without judgment.
Research Implications
Current findings suggest that traditional addiction models require modification for neurodivergent populations. Dr. Mitchell emphasizes that understanding neurological foundations can reduce stigma while improving treatment effectiveness.
"When we recognise substance use as attempted neurological self-correction rather than moral failing, we can develop interventions that actually address underlying needs," Mitchell explains.
Future Directions
Research teams are investigating several promising areas:
Genetic markers predicting substance use vulnerability in ADHD populations
Novel therapeutic approaches combining ADHD symptom management with addiction treatment
Long-term outcomes of harm reduction versus abstinence-only approaches
Environmental and policy interventions to reduce risk factors
